Commit Graph

3677 Commits (64273d58e34516a9ae8b3df3de2156ffc5736556)

Author SHA1 Message Date
Kim Kulling 82f73b6d03 OpenGEX: fix invalid access to textures. Next steps to camera and light. 2016-05-08 11:09:53 +02:00
Kim Kulling 513576616c Merge branch 'master' of https://github.com/assimp/assimp 2016-05-07 18:01:21 +02:00
Kim Kulling 896e139470 Merge pull request #879 from gorilux/master
Added 3MF importer
2016-05-07 18:00:13 +02:00
Gorilux 00b574d746 Fixed compile issue for travis-ci 2016-05-07 15:36:05 +02:00
Gorilux 753b63c526 Removed override keywords so compilation success on gcc 4.6 2016-05-07 15:15:00 +02:00
Gorilux 89320bab46 Merge branch 'master' of https://github.com/assimp/assimp 2016-05-07 14:18:17 +02:00
Gorilux 8f4f0047fb Added 3MF importer 2016-05-07 14:16:33 +02:00
Kim Kulling 301b6798c5 aiLight: fix a typo. 2016-05-07 11:16:33 +02:00
Alexander Gessler a931d2bac6 Merge pull request #877 from assimp/followups
Followups
2016-05-05 20:40:54 +02:00
Alexander Gessler 0b79d1ebda Revert previous glTF fix (e5233283ef) because it breaks ODR as pointed out by @turol, instead just make importer depend on the necessary definitions. 2016-05-05 19:11:33 +02:00
Alexander Gessler f5327a99ba Add using namespace std on top of assxml exporter so vsnprintf is found no matter where it lives. 2016-05-05 19:05:02 +02:00
Alexander Gessler 92b1431be3 Merge pull request #876 from assimp/travisfix
Fix travis compile: glTFImporter chokes on unavailability of WriteLaz…
2016-05-05 17:59:04 +02:00
Alexander Gessler c80fe16323 Update regression test suite.
gltf could be a regression, left a question here: https://github.com/assimp/assimp/pull/697
2016-05-05 16:59:26 +02:00
Alexander Gessler e5233283ef Fix travis compile: glTFImporter chokes on unavailability of WriteLazyDict<T>. It does not use it directly, but instantiation of LazyDict<T> creates a reference.
My understanding is that compilers were correct in rejecting this, but I may be missing some detail of C++' template instantiation rules.
2016-05-05 16:37:55 +02:00
Alexander Gessler 174a598759 Merge pull request #875 from assimp/acgmay16
MSVC11 fixes
2016-05-05 16:04:10 +02:00
Alexander Gessler 896120b76a Assimp mostly uses unsigned int where it perhaps should've used size_t, nonetheless SPBC insisted on size_t, causing lots of noisy compile warnings. 2016-05-05 15:41:50 +02:00
Alexander Gessler 167bc579c5 Fix MSVC11 compile error in AssxmlExporter.cpp -- vsnprintf is not in std. 2016-05-05 15:41:12 +02:00
Alexander Gessler 1daae7b7b9 STEPFile.h: delete deleted copy ctor and move ctors. Class has a const member, so implicit creation is off anyway. Enables pre cpp11 compilation. 2016-05-05 15:40:36 +02:00
Alexander Gessler e7fd168114 Merge pull request #854 from tomacd/fix_scene_combiner
fix SceneCombiner copy of aiNode not setting mParent field
2016-05-05 15:07:09 +02:00
Kim Kulling e9b93788ca Merge pull request #863 from mpersano/master
Fix texture coords exporting on binary PLY files
2016-05-03 21:55:17 +02:00
Richard Selneck 12613720ff Fix macro used for detecting IRR support 2016-05-02 18:24:26 -04:00
Kim Kulling 8449afad71 Merge pull request #868 from otgerrogla/master
Fixed a few GLTF importer/exporter bugs
2016-04-28 22:56:41 +02:00
Otger 11e52dc3d7 Removed rogue comma 2016-04-28 21:34:31 +02:00
Otger 2fe401fc54 Fixed gcc compilation error 2016-04-28 21:22:01 +02:00
Otger 64f78e003f Fixed crashes when files were not found, and fixed some warnings 2016-04-28 20:50:01 +02:00
Kim Kulling 46e7ae5dc0 OpenGEX: prepare light- and camera-node and object. 2016-04-28 20:20:40 +02:00
Otger d9b365eb90 Fixed a few GLTF importer/exporter bugs 2016-04-28 18:44:47 +02:00
Kim Kulling 97145a7f20 Replace std:.endl by backslash n. 2016-04-27 17:59:12 +02:00
Kim Kulling 5192b837da Replace std::endl by using backslash n. 2016-04-27 17:58:40 +02:00
Kim Kulling 7468ca5c35 VS2015-code analysis: fix finding ( index var type too small ). 2016-04-23 09:43:20 +02:00
Kim Kulling fcd1f21231 Merge branch 'master' of https://github.com/assimp/assimp 2016-04-23 09:42:57 +02:00
Kim Kulling 388694e349 cmake build env: add missing license info. 2016-04-23 09:42:27 +02:00
Kim Kulling 829e56df0c cmake env: add license info. 2016-04-23 09:42:05 +02:00
mpersano 473d2ca052 Fix texture coords exporting on binary PLY files 2016-04-22 16:09:45 -03:00
Kim Kulling 2a3c2e3a21 Merge pull request #861 from v4hn/no-locallib
only check a library folder if it actually exists
2016-04-22 11:54:40 +02:00
Michael Görner f1a984bd3b only check a library folder if it actually exists
otherwise this breaks for no reason if /usr/local/lib is missing.
2016-04-22 11:35:44 +02:00
Kim Kulling f905f5700f regression ui: add default editor for linux. 2016-04-21 19:19:06 +02:00
Kim Kulling af75390f8d travis: fix a typo. 2016-04-21 18:21:32 +02:00
Kim Kulling f9cba1c4ea regression test suite: fix usage of run. 2016-04-21 17:24:01 +02:00
Kim Kulling 53263953c5 travis: fix usage of runner script for regression testsuite. 2016-04-21 17:14:54 +02:00
Kim Kulling b120454bdd Merge pull request #860 from Squareys/fix-pi
Fix Mistake in last Pullrequest
2016-04-21 17:07:27 +02:00
Squareys 6bc36eb2b6 Fix mistake while switching to new PI constants
From previous pullrequest (https://github.com/assimp/assimp/pull/859),
commit 7c0e40a3f4 introduced the error.

Thanks @mosra for catching it!

Signed-off-by: Squareys <Squareys@googlemail.com>
2016-04-21 15:23:14 +02:00
Kim Kulling 6107ead295 Merge pull request #859 from Squareys/fix-pi
Add definition for PI and PI_2
2016-04-21 10:58:10 +02:00
Squareys 7c0e40a3f4 Add definition for PI and PI_2
M_PI and M_PI_2 are not C++ standard and are therefore not present, in
MinGW-w64 gcc 5.1.0 for example. We therefore replace it with an own
definition.

Since math.h was only included for M_PI and M_PI_2 makros, we can now
remove it.

Signed-off-by: Squareys <Squareys@googlemail.com>
2016-04-21 08:17:06 +02:00
Kim Kulling 019226c119 CMake build: enabme c++11 for mingw. 2016-04-21 00:02:28 +02:00
Kim Kulling 2f9c33e3e9 closes https://github.com/assimp/assimp/issues/857 2016-04-20 23:27:59 +02:00
Kim Kulling 69ac97d709 Update run.py
resolve conflict.
2016-04-20 12:37:48 +02:00
Kim Kulling c122bb2def Regression test suite: update run. 2016-04-20 00:04:26 +02:00
Kim Kulling 3659570292 regression ui: add missing functionalities for setup, version and update. 2016-04-19 16:01:21 +02:00
Kim Kulling 0ec1e91722 Regression Testsuite: update database. 2016-04-19 08:49:14 +02:00